The Le Soléal is a cruise ship owned by the French cruise company Compagnie du Ponant .

history

The ship was built under construction number 6229 at the Fincantieri - Cantieri Navali Italiani shipyard in Ancona, Italy . The ship was undocked in early December 2012. After completion, the ship was delivered to Compagnie du Ponant on June 28, 2013 and christened and commissioned in Venice on June 29 . The godmother was Kiki Tauck Mahar, wife of the CEO of the US tour operator Tauck. The construction costs were given at around 100 million euros.

Technical data and equipment

The ship is powered by two electric motors with an output of 2,300  kW each. The motors act on two fixed propellers . The ship reaches a speed of up to 16  knots .

Four diesel generators each with an output of 1,600 kW ( apparent power : 2,000  kVA ) as well as a generator with an output of 800 kW (apparent power: 1000 kVA) and a generator with an output of 600 kW (apparent power: 750 kVA) are available for the power supply Available.

The ship has 132 passenger cabins and can accommodate 264 passengers with double occupancy. All cabins are outside cabins. Only eight cabins do not have their own balcony.

The hull of the ship is reinforced with ice ( ice class 1C), so the ship can also be used in the polar regions. In order to be able to bring passengers ashore during expedition cruises even in areas without port infrastructure, the ship is equipped with Zodiac inflatable boats.
